Side-by-side financial comparison of Liberty Broadband Corp (LBRDA) and MARTIN MIDSTREAM PARTNERS L.P. (MMLP).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Liberty Broadband Corp is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($261.0M vs $187.7M, roughly 1.4× MARTIN MIDSTREAM PARTNERS L.P.). Liberty Broadband Corp runs the higher net margin — 146.7% vs 1.7%, a 145.0%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Liberty Broadband Corp pos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(6.1% vs -2.5%). Liberty Broadband Corp produced more free cash flow last quarter ($37.0M vs $-6.0M). Over the past eight quarters, Liberty Broadband Corp's revenue compounded faster (4.3% CAGR vs 0.8%).

Martin Midstream Partners L.P. is a U.S.-based midstream energy services provider. It offers storage, transportation, distribution and processing solutions for crude oil, natural gas liquids, refined petroleum products and specialty chemicals, mainly serving customers across North American energy and industrial segments.
